Elevating Biomass Energy with SERVODAY's Torrefaction Plant

SERVODAY's Biomass and Wood Torrefaction Plant revolutionizes the conversion of raw biomass into high-energy torrefied products, optimizing them for diverse energy applications. Starting at the receiving section, raw biomass is processed and then directed to the torrefaction reactor. Here, it undergoes controlled heating without oxygen, producing torrefied biomass with enhanced energy density and storage capabilities. The material is then cooled and stored for future use. The plant features key equipment such as biomass receiving systems, torrefaction reactors, cooling units, and storage silos, all engineered for maximum efficiency.   • Advanced, Controlled Torrefaction Technology
    At the heart of the Malone plant is the torrefaction reactor, which uses a precision-controlled heating process in an oxygen-deficient environment. This enhances the biomass's energy density, simplifies grinding, and boosts its water resistance, making it a high-performance fuel source in Malone, Texas.
